About EIG Employers Holdings Inc

Employers Holdings Inc is a provider of workers' compensation insurance and services focused on small and mid-sized businesses engaged in low-to-medium hazard industries. Its customers are employers, and the insurance premiums that those employers pay to account for company revenue. Substantially all of the remaining revenue is generated through investments. The company operates exclusively in the United States, and it generates more than half of its business in California. By industry, the company has exposure to restaurants, which account for roughly a fourth of the total premiums the company earns. It operates as a single reportable segment, Insurance Operations, through its wholly owned subsidiaries.

About ROOT Root Inc.

Root Inc develops and launches a direct-to-consumer personal automobile insurance and mobile technology company. It generates revenue from the sales of auto insurance policies within the United States.
